Once a year, on #Pentecost Sunday, rose petals are dropped from the oculus of the Pantheon in Rome while the “Veni Creator Spiritus” is chanted. I’ve seen it once a few years ago. These pilgrims were blessed to see it, today! From Darius Arya

Pentecost commemorates when Jesus sent the Holy Spirit to be with the disciples (Acts 2). With the Holy Spirit among the disciples, the church was born.
